What happened
NASA's Artemis II astronauts successfully performed a trans-lunar injection burn, moving towards a lunar flyby trajectory.
The Context
- Historic Milestone: This mission marks the first crewed deep-space operation beyond low Earth orbit since 1972.
- International Collaboration: The mission includes participation from Canada, highlighting global partnerships in space exploration.
- Economic Impact: Florida anticipates a $150 million economic boost from the launch, benefiting local businesses and tourism.
